[latex3-commits] [git/LaTeX3-latex3-latex2e] hotfix/gh577: Merge branch 'main' into hotfix/gh577 ; added fix description to latexchanges.txt (0496c406)

Frank Mittelbach frank.mittelbach at latex-project.org
Mon Jun 7 09:30:26 CEST 2021


Repository : https://github.com/latex3/latex2e
On branch  : hotfix/gh577
Link       : https://github.com/latex3/latex2e/commit/0496c4061fd0f2aab0cc6f0f375aef893851025e

>---------------------------------------------------------------

commit 0496c4061fd0f2aab0cc6f0f375aef893851025e
Merge: 07750e06 5a5f6a68
Author: Frank Mittelbach <frank.mittelbach at latex-project.org>
Date:   Mon Jun 7 09:30:26 2021 +0200

    Merge branch 'main' into hotfix/gh577 ; added fix description to latexchanges.txt


>---------------------------------------------------------------

0496c4061fd0f2aab0cc6f0f375aef893851025e
 base/changes.txt                                   | 13 +++++++-
 base/doc/latexchanges.tex                          | 18 +++++++++-
 base/ltclass.dtx                                   | 39 ++++++++++++++++++++--
 base/testfiles/github-0479-often.luatex.tlg        |  2 ++
 base/testfiles/github-0479-often.tlg               |  2 ++
 base/testfiles/github-0479-often.xetex.tlg         |  2 ++
 base/testfiles/github-0580.lvt                     | 18 ++++++++++
 base/testfiles/github-0580.tlg                     |  8 +++++
 .../tlb-latexrelease-rollback-003-often.luatex.tlg |  4 +++
 .../tlb-latexrelease-rollback-003-often.tlg        |  4 +++
 .../tlb-latexrelease-rollback-003-often.xetex.tlg  |  4 +++
 base/testfiles/tlb-rollback-004-often.luatex.tlg   |  2 ++
 base/testfiles/tlb-rollback-004-often.tlg          |  2 ++
 base/testfiles/tlb-rollback-004-often.xetex.tlg    |  2 ++
 base/testfiles/tlb-rollback-005.luatex.tlg         |  2 ++
 base/testfiles/tlb-rollback-005.tlg                |  2 ++
 base/testfiles/tlb-rollback-005.xetex.tlg          |  2 ++
 17 files changed, 121 insertions(+), 5 deletions(-)

diff --cc base/changes.txt
index ec21d4b5,20f43334..136554a6
--- a/base/changes.txt
+++ b/base/changes.txt
@@@ -10,13 -10,19 +10,24 @@@ are not part of the distribution
  All changes above are only part of the development branch for the next release.
  ================================================================================
  
+ #########################
+ # 2021-06-01 PL1 Release
+ #########################
+ 
+ 2021-06-06  David Carlisle  <David.Carlisle at latex-project.org>
+ 
+ 	* ltclass.dtx: ensure raw option lists are copied in short circuit
+ 	loading by \LoadClassWithOptions, expand one step so
+ 	\CurrentOption expanded (gh #580)
+ 
 +2021-06-03  Phelype Oleinik  <phelype.oleinik at latex-project.org>
 +
 +	* ltclass.dtx:
 +	Keep file path stack in sync when rolling back/forward (gh/577).
 +
+ 
  #########################
- # 2020-06-01 Release
+ # 2021-06-01 Release
  #########################
  
  2021-05-31  David Carlisle  <David.Carlisle at latex-project.org>
diff --cc base/doc/latexchanges.tex
index bc8e8dd0,b4f213c5..baeb0f85
--- a/base/doc/latexchanges.tex
+++ b/base/doc/latexchanges.tex
@@@ -41,7 -41,7 +41,7 @@@
  \author{\copyright~Copyright 2015--2021, \LaTeX\ Project Team.\\
     All rights reserved.}
  
- \date{2021-01-08}
 -\date{2021-06-06}
++\date{2021-06-07}
  
  % a few commands from doc
  \newcommand\Lpack[1]{\mbox{\textsf{#1}}}
@@@ -111,7 -111,18 +111,23 @@@ see for exampl
  
  %\section{Introduction}
  
+ \section{Changes introduced in 2021-06-01 patch~1}
  
+ A further refinement to the handling of ``raw'' option lists added
+ in the last release, see \ghissue{508}.
+ 
++Fixes an issue with rollback when \pkg{latexrelease} is loaded by some
++other package (as done for \texttt{platex} (\ghissue{577}).
++
++
++
+ \section{Changes introduced in 2021-06-01}
+ 
+ The focus of this release is to provide further important building
+ blocks for the future production of reliable tagged PDF output.  Many
+ other improvements have been made. Please see \ltnewsissue{33} for an
+ overview of the new features and the change log in
+ \texttt{changes.txt} for a more detailed list of individual changes.
  
  \section{Changes introduced in 2020-10-01 patch~4}
  





More information about the latex3-commits mailing list.